Update #2: All NOAA-20 OMPS Nadir Mapper (NM) SDRs and EDRs (V8TOz & V8TOS) products are approved for operational use and the NCCF/PDA subscriptions for these products will be enabled at 19:00 UTC, April 11, 2025. Direct Broadcast (DB) users can use the equivalent OMPS NM Community Satellite Processing Package (CSPP) LEO products for operations.
OMPS Nadir Profiler (NP) SDRs and EDRs (V8Pro) will be enabled once additional OMPS SDR Look Up Tables (LUTs) are ingested into operations next week.
Update #1: As of April 2, 2025 at 17:03 UTC, NOAA-20 OMPS transitioned into Safe Hold mode. Engineering was able to recover it back to a nominal status on April 2, 2025 at 20:36Z. All PDA OPS subscriptions for all NOAA-20 OMPS products have been disabled until an analysis is conducted by Cal/Val teams to be cleared for use in operations.
Topic: NOAA-20 Drag Make-Up Maneuver (DMU) scheduled for April 02, 2025
Date/Time Issued: April 11, 2025 1904Z
Product(s) or Data Impacted: All NOAA-20 Sensor Data
Date/Time of Initial Impact: April 02, 2025 1653Z
Date/Time of Expected End: April 02, 2025 1940Z
Length of Outage: See Details.
Details/Specifics: On April 02, 2025 17:19:00Z,
NOAA-20 will perform a 5.0 second propulsive Drag Makeup Maneuver (DMU)
to maintain Mean Local Time of the Ascending Node while controlling Repeating Ground Track box.
The following observatory systems will be affected on April 02, 2025:
- 16:53:32Z – 19:00:40Z CERES in Contam-Safe mode, science data will not be available
- 17:04:00Z – 17:29:10Z OMPS in Decon mode, Science data will not be available
- 17:08:00Z – 17:12:24Z HRD will be off, data for direct broadcast users will be unavailable
- 17:13:00Z – 17:19:05Z N20 in Control Frame 2 (DMU) (Delta-V Control Frame)
- 17:13:00Z – 17:26:10Z N20 pointing off-nadir, collected data during that time period may be impacted and not disseminate
